Visual Studio/.NET Framework

T17 Moving DevOps to the Cloud Using Visual Studio Online, Release Management Online, and Azure

03/17/2015

1:30pm - 2:45pm

Level: Introductory

Donovan Brown

Principal DevOps Program Manager

Microsoft

This session demos using Desired State Configuration (DSC) with Release Management Online (RMO) for Visual Studio Online (VSO) to tackle real-world deployment challenges to the cloud via Azure. We start by presenting an overview of the key concepts, architecture, and configuration of the various components. We discuss the out-of-the box deployment actions available to compose automations for common deployment scenarios and how to use extensibility to cover the not-so-common scenarios. In more detail, we discuss adding custom DSC resources, how to trigger release as part of a build and how to leverage logs to diagnose failed releases. These are presented through specific scenarios encountered in the field.